Starter Fluid Management
Starter Fluid Management was a Silicon Valley venture capital fund headquartered in San Francisco, United States. The firm was founded and managed by Robert von Goeben. Starter Fluid was backed by institutional investors, including Compaq Computers and the University of Chicago. The firm operated as a venture capital fund focused on the Silicon Valley ecosystem.
